General Notes: Husband - R. G. Lutton


He was educated in the public schools of North Strabane Township, Washington County, Pennsylvania; as well as Washington and Jefferson College and Duff 's Business College, at Pittsburgh. He then returned to the farm and engaged in agricultural pursuits until he came to Washington borough. There, in association with C. E. and W. E. Carothers, he established the Pasteur Dairy which did an extensive business in mill and ice cream. Mr. Lutton was a stockholder in the Canonsburg Steel and Iron Company, and was a stockholder and director in the Farmers' Mutual Telephone Company. He took a very active interest in all public movements and was an influential Republican politician, for two years serving on the Republican County Committee and assisting in the direction of local matters. Mr. Lutton was reared in the faith of the Presbyterian Church and was a member of the old church of this body, Presbyterian Hill Church, near Canonsburg. Fraternally he was a Knight Templar Mason and an Elk, and he belonged also to the exclusive Bassett Club.

He was a member of the city council from the Second Ward, deputy sheriff of the county and part proprietor of the Pasteur Dairy.
